- 2007-11-13 22:16:19 - Optimizing your cash flow with proper accounts receivable management
- Businesses miss on growth opportunities and even close their doors every day, not because they aren't profitable enough, but because they are strangled by poor cash flow. The problem is that while their profit and loss statement shows success, their bank account cries poor. - 2007-11-13 22:16:19 - Get down with ocp: evaluating dba job applicants in an ocp world
- Not long ago, weeding through DBA applicants with a tech interview was a straightforward process. You'd ask candidates 200 or so technical questions. If they got 100 correct answers, you knew they'd been around the block; 150 or more and you knew you were on to superior talent.
